Here at the Washington State Department of Veterans Affairs (WDVA), we are passionate about our mission of "Serving Those Who Served." As a national leader in our advocacy for more than 500,000 veterans and their family members, we strive to connect them to earned benefits as well as innovative programs focused on their overall health and wellness. In addition, we provide critical community services through a variety of programs, and at our four State Veterans Homes located in Orting, Port Orchard, Spokane, and Walla Walla. These locations provide Medicare and Medicaid nursing home care to honorably discharged veterans, including, in some instances, their spouses, widows, or Gold Star Families. As a Food Service Worker for our Washington Soldiers Home, you'll be responsible for distributing food in a safe and sanitary manner, while also ensuring the nutritional needs of our residents are met. Cultivate your culinary career and put your customer service skills to work by serving America's heroes!Some of what you will be doing: Ensuring residents are given nutritional meals, snacks and supplements by reading and following prescribed diets and food preferences. Ensuring food is prepared safely; monitoring storage methods, food production and holding temperatures per regulations. Performing simple cooking such as toast, boiled eggs, hot cereal; washing and peeling vegetables and fruits, etc. Monitoring refrigeration units for outdated products. Setting up and serving food orders; refilling condiments and napkins; monitoring and setting up salad bar. Cleaning and sanitizing equipment and area, and other assigned duties. The Dishwasher is directly responsible for the washing and cleaning of all tableware, pots, pans and cooking equipment, floors, walls, coolers, ceiling, etc. Responsible for keeping the kitchen and equipment clean and organized at all times. Qualifications: Must have a strong work ethic and a positive attitude. Must be able to load, run, and unload dish machine. Ability to keep the dish machine clean and functional. Ability to understands and executes proper storage and usage of cleaning supplies. Must be able to adhere to "First in First out principles" for proper rotation in order to minimize food loss. Ability to close the kitchen properly and follows the closing checklist for kitchen stations. Able to assist with checking refrigeration points and ensure all Temp logs are filled out properly. Must have strong organizational skills Able to effectively communicate with Team Members, Team Leaders and Store Leadership. Ability to work a variety of shifts including nights, weekends and holidays. Ability to bend and stoop to grasp objects, climb ladders, lift loads up to 50 lbs. unassisted, push and pull carts weighing up to 100 lbs. unassisted. Ability to stand for up to 4 hours without a break. Responsibilities: Provide exceptional Guest Service or get help to do so. Load, run, and unload dish machine Keep the dish machine clean and report any functional or mechanical problems immediately to the Kitchen Team Leader. Bag and haul trash to dumpster at designated times. Bag and store linens in appropriate location at designated times. Understands and executes the 12 steps to a successful NSF audit which ensures the highest level of food safety and sanitation. Understands and executes proper storage and usage of cleaning supplies. Adheres to "First in First out principles" for proper rotation in order to minimize food loss. Performs other related duties as assigned by the Kitchen Manager or manager-on-duty. Attends all scheduled Team Member meetings and brings suggestions for improvement. Closes the kitchen properly and follows the closing checklist for kitchen stations or assists others in closing the kitchen. Assist with checking refrigeration points and ensure all Temp logs are filled out properly.
